MRI-based Muscle Analysis with Dr. Doug Goldstein #825
Episode 825
Wednesday, 26 November, 2025

In this episode, the Barbell Shrugged crew explores how next-generation MRI muscle analysis is transforming the way high-performing athletes train, recover, and prevent injury. Dr. Doug Goldstein walks Anders Varner, Doug Larson, and Travis Mash through Doug Larson's full Springbok Analytics scan a 3D "digital twin" of his musculoskeletal system that reveals muscle volume, asymmetries, and tissue quality with a level of precision traditional assessments can't match. The team breaks down how this data gives coaches a clearer understanding of the body's true strengths, weak links, and compensation patterns the foundational context needed to prescribe smarter, more targeted programming. Using Doug's real data as the case study, the group highlights how seemingly isolated issues like a long-healed posterior hip dislocation can create downstream patterns that affect performance years later. The scan reveals major asymmetries in deep hip stabilizers, psoas imbalances, and elevated intramuscular fat in specific muscles, all of which influence how force is produced and absorbed under load. The conversation emphasizes that measuring muscle quality and not just quantity is essential for identifying tissues that underperform despite looking normal from the outside. They also break down the different types of fat Springbok identifies (visceral, subcutaneous, intermuscular, intramuscular) and why certain compartments are more predictive of movement limitations, metabolic dysfunction, or elevated injury risk. The episode closes with a look at how this new level of precision plugs into a fully integrated high-performance system. Through Optima Muscle, athletes combine Springbok MRI data with movement evaluations, strength testing, and force analysis to build individualized protocols that increase strength, improve resilience, and significantly reduce the risk of non-contact injuries. The team explains why pro athletes are beginning to adopt multi-scan protocols across a season, and how this data-driven approach allows coaches to design programming that targets exactly the right tissues, at exactly the right time. For anyone serious about longevity in training, staying explosive, or eliminating preventable injuries, this episode offers a glimpse into the future of performance diagnostics and precision training.
